About Severn, North Carolina

Located in Northampton County, Severn is a small town in North Carolina. With a population of just over 200 residents, Severn is a tight-knit community that offers a peaceful and serene environment. The town is situated in the northeastern part of the state, approximately 90 miles from the state capital, Raleigh. Despite its small size, Severn is rich in history and culture, with a number of historical landmarks and sites that reflect its past.

Severn is characterized by its rural setting, with agriculture playing a significant role in the local economy. The town is surrounded by vast farmlands, with crops such as soybeans, cotton, and peanuts being the main produce. The community is also known for its warm and friendly residents who are always ready to lend a helping hand. Severn Public Records

Severn Public Records are documents and information that are available to the public in accordance with the North Carolina Public Records Law. These records include documents from various government agencies and departments, such as court records, property records, marriage and divorce records, birth and death records, business licenses, and more.

Accessing Severn Public Records

Accessing Severn Public Records is a straightforward process. The North Carolina Public Records Law allows any member of the public to request access to public records, regardless of the purpose of the request. To access these records, individuals can submit a request to the relevant government agency or department. The request can be made in person, by mail, or online, depending on the agency's policies.

Northampton County Register of Deeds

The Northampton County Register of Deeds is responsible for maintaining and providing access to a variety of public records, including property records, marriage licenses, and birth and death certificates. The office is located at 102 Northampton Drive, Jackson, NC 27845. They can be reached by phone at (252) 534-2511. More information can be found on their website at www.northamptonnc.com/deeds.html.

Northampton County Clerk of Superior Court

The Northampton County Clerk of Superior Court maintains and provides access to court records. The office is located at 104 West Jefferson Street, Jackson, NC 27845. They can be reached by phone at (252) 574-3100. More information can be found on their website at www.nccourts.gov/locations/northampton-county.

Severn Town Hall

The Severn Town Hall is another place where you can access Severn Public Records. The Town Hall is responsible for maintaining records related to the town's operations, including meeting minutes, ordinances, and resolutions. The Severn Town Hall is located at 115 West Main Street, Severn, NC 27877. They can be reached by phone at (252) 585-0488.

Online Access to Severn Public Records

In addition to physical locations, Severn Public Records can also be accessed online. The North Carolina Department of Natural and Cultural Resources has a searchable online database where individuals can access a variety of public records. The database can be accessed at www.ncdcr.gov.
